Brendan Moore (born 17 February 1972, in Sheffield)[1] is an English former professional snooker referee.
[1][2][3] Moore took charge of three World Snooker Championship finals, in 2014,[4] 2018,[5] and 2023.
[7] Moore has been in charge of ten tournament matches that have contained maximum breaks.
[citation needed] Following the 2023 World Snooker Championship final, Moore retired from snooker to become tournament director for Matchroom Pool.
